Samsung hikes storage-based prices across Galaxy phones and tablets amid RAM shortage

TL;DR Summary
Samsung is raising prices on higher-storage variants of the Galaxy Z Flip 7, Galaxy S25 FE, and Galaxy S25 Edge (up to $80 more), with earlier hikes on the Galaxy Z Fold 7; its tablet lineup also sees price increases (e.g., Tab S11, S11 Ultra, S10 FE, Tab A11 Plus) as memory shortages push RAM and NAND costs higher.
